中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

oracle分表后如何維護數據一致性

小樊
83
2024-07-18 12:11:47
欄目: 云計算

在Oracle數據庫中進行分表操作后,需要考慮如何維護數據一致性。以下是一些常見的方法:

  1. 使用分區表:Oracle數據庫提供了分區表的功能,可以根據指定的字段自動將數據分散到不同的物理存儲空間中。這樣可以減少數據訪問的負載,并提高查詢效率。

  2. 使用觸發器:可以創建觸發器來在數據插入、更新或刪除時執行特定的操作,以保證數據的一致性。例如,可以在插入數據時同時插入到多個分表中。

  3. 使用分布式事務:如果需要在多個分表之間執行復雜的事務操作,可以使用分布式事務來確保數據的一致性。Oracle數據庫支持分布式事務處理,可以跨多個數據庫實例執行事務。

  4. 使用分布式鎖:在并發環境下,可能會出現數據沖突的情況。可以使用分布式鎖來確保在對數據進行操作時只有一個會話能夠訪問數據,以避免數據不一致的情況。

  5. 定期進行數據同步:定期進行數據同步操作,將數據從一個分表同步到另一個分表,以保證數據的一致性。可以使用Oracle的數據同步工具或自定義腳本來實現數據同步操作。

綜上所述,通過合理設計數據分表結構和采取相應的維護數據一致性措施,可以有效地保證Oracle數據庫分表后數據的一致性。

0
广南县| 济阳县| 新田县| 江口县| 肇州县| 泾川县| 库尔勒市| 江安县| 象州县| 应城市| 光泽县| 乐都县| 防城港市| 平泉县| 台前县| 新源县| 通城县| 开江县| 沿河| 栾城县| 鹤壁市| 大方县| 秦皇岛市| 凤阳县| 林甸县| 大安市| 西峡县| 长宁县| 阜南县| 金溪县| 襄汾县| 澄城县| 西华县| 武穴市| 西乌| 濮阳县| 嘉兴市| 南和县| 丹江口市| 建平县| 江油市|